What is an AI Agent in HR?
AI agents are digital assistants powered by complex algorithms that can perform tasks typically handled by HR professionals. These tasks range from mundane clerical work to intricate decision-making processes. With their ability to learn and adapt, AI agents offer a versatile solution for managing HR challenges.
The Benefits of AI Agents in HR
Integrating AI agents into HR practices brings numerous benefits:
- Efficiency Boost: AI agents handle repetitive tasks swiftly, freeing up human HR specialists to focus on more strategic activities.
- Cost Savings: By reducing the need for a large workforce to handle administrative tasks, AI can help cut operational costs.
- Enhanced Decision Making: Through data analysis, AI agents provide valuable insights that help HR leaders make informed decisions.
- Personalized Employee Support: AI can provide customized responses and suggestions to employees based on their unique needs and preferences.

Challenges to Consider
While the benefits are compelling, integrating AI agents into HR comes with its own set of challenges. Organizations must address concerns around data privacy and ensure that AI systems are managed with a strong ethical framework. Additionally, there’s a need for ongoing training to ensure AI systems remain up-to-date and effective.
Ensuring Ethical AI Use
Ethical considerations include transparency, fairness, and accountability in AI operations. Organizations must prioritize building systems that not only comply with regulatory frameworks but also maintain trust among employees. Striking the right balance between innovation and ethical responsibility is paramount for successful AI integration.
